It is a widely held view that attribution to the two wives is indicative of an early stage of tribal organization, the tribes of Leah and the tribes of Rachel. The attribution of four tribes to handmaids may indicate either a lowered status or late entry into the confederation. The likelihood of a multiplicity of shrines is strengthened by the fact that clusters of Canaanite settlements separated the southern and central tribes and divided the central tribes from those in Galilee. The passage in I Chronicles 5:12 illustrates well how the dominant position among the tribes passed from Reuben to Ephraim and from Ephraim to Judah. Others feel that the tribes descended from the matriarch Leah - namely Reuben, Simeon, Levi, Judah, Zebulun and Issachar - existed at an earlier stage as a confederation of six tribes whose boundaries in Canaan were contiguous. The confederation of the twelve tribes was primarily religious, based upon belief in the one God of Israel with whom the tribes had made a covenant and whom they worshiped at a common sacral center as the people of the Lord. The Tent of Meeting and the Ark of the Covenant were the most sacred objects of the tribal union and biblical tradition shows that many places served as religious centers in various periods. 1:1-5). The incidents of the concubine in Gibeah and Sauls battle with Nahash the Ammonite are classic examples of joint action taken by the league of twelve tribes acting as one man, from Dan even to Beer-Sheba, with the land of Gilead. In the one case, unified action was taken by the tribes against one of their members, Benjamin, for a breach of the terms of the covenant. Each of the twelve tribes enjoyed a good deal of autonomy, ordering its own affairs after the patriarchal-tribal pattern. We also use third-party cookies that help us analyze and understand how you use this website. Reubens place as head of the twelve tribes was taken by the house of Joseph which played a decisive and historic role during the periods of the settlement and the Judges. It is apparent, however, from Ezekiels eschatological vision that the awareness of Israel as a people composed of twelve tribes had not, even then, become effaced. For the same duodecimal considerations, Simeon is counted as a tribe even after having been absorbed into Judah, and Manasseh even after having split in two, is considered one.
